## Limits & Quotas — Drossel Baseline File

The Drossel static-analysis baseline caps how many suppressed findings a service may carry. On-call engineers should reject merges that exceed the quota rather than regenerating the baseline. Growth above the soft limit pages the owning team. The enforced constants are listed below.

tuning constants:
QUOTAS = {
    "quenael": 10,
    "oliwyn": 1,
}

**14:22 UTC — Export timezone defect confirmed.** The Quillbeam reporting service generated scheduled exports using the worker host's local zone instead of the tenant-configured zone, shifting all timestamps in the Velmora region by three hours. Affected exports between 09:00 and 14:10 UTC were quarantined. Future maintainers should note the fix landed in the formatter, not the scheduler, which remained correct throughout. The patched artifact that restored correct behavior carries the build token shown below.

session token of tajog-fahaf = htk21_4ae55819f45410afcb307

## Step 2: Migrate the restock planner

Welcome aboard. The Snackline restock planner is moving from the nightly batch model to continuous scheduling. Before touching any code, back up the route tables, then disable the legacy cron job so the two planners never run concurrently. Verify machine inventory counts match the warehouse ledger. Once verified, apply the configuration values listed below.

config for kagup-hahig:
druwyn:
  pin: 2801
  metrics_host: metrics.druwyn.zemvarlabs.internal
  tenant: sorius
  seal: seal_798a43d7

## Harrowfield Gateway — Environments

Quick rundown for the security review: the Harrowfield telemetry gateway ingests data from combines and seeders across the Velden test farms. Dev and staging use synthetic tractor feeds; prod takes live traffic. TLS is enforced everywhere except dev. The staging environment currently runs with these settings.

config for tawif-bagef:
[sorwyn]
team = sorys
access_code = ac_9ba40c
host = sorwyn.ordingrid.local
port = 5000
owner = aldok.quenion
peer = belath.paliqcloud.local